S-1: Vaxart Files S-1 for $25M Equity Financing

Sentiment:

Registration Statement (Form S-1)


Vaxart, Inc. has registered up to 32.9 million shares of common stock for resale by Lincoln Park Capital Fund, LLC to support its ongoing clinical development programs.

Delay expectedThe filing notes multiple stop work orders issued by ATI/BARDA regarding the COVID-19 Phase 2b trial, which have impacted enrollment and funding scope.
Capital raiseThe filing details a Purchase Agreement with Lincoln Park Capital Fund, LLC for up to $25 million in committed equity financing.

Summary

  • The filing registers 32,914,599 shares of common stock for resale by Lincoln Park Capital Fund, LLC.
  • This includes 32,467,532 shares issuable under a $25 million committed equity financing agreement (Purchase Agreement) and 447,067 commitment shares already issued.
  • The Company will not receive proceeds from the resale of shares by Lincoln Park, but may receive up to $25 million in gross proceeds from the sale of shares to Lincoln Park under the Purchase Agreement.
  • As of March 31, 2026, the Company reported $61.0 million in cash, cash equivalents, and investments.
  • The Company has an accumulated deficit of $455.0 million as of March 31, 2026.

Positives

  • Secured a $25 million committed equity financing facility to support operations.
  • Reported $61.0 million in cash, cash equivalents, and investments as of March 31, 2026, providing runway into the second quarter of 2027.
  • Management concluded that conditions previously raising substantial doubt about the Company's ability to continue as a going concern have been alleviated.
  • Received $316.0 million in total funding available under the 2024 ATI-RRPV Contract as of March 10, 2026.

Negatives

  • The Company has incurred significant losses since inception and expects to continue incurring losses for the foreseeable future.
  • Common stock was delisted from Nasdaq in November 2025 and is currently traded on the OTCQX, which may negatively impact liquidity and stock price.
  • The Company is dependent on third-party contract manufacturers and clinical research organizations, which introduces significant operational risks.
  • The Company has no approved products in late-stage clinical development and may never achieve profitability.

Risks

  • Dilution to existing stockholders resulting from the issuance of shares to Lincoln Park.
  • Uncertainty regarding the regulatory pathway for norovirus and COVID-19 vaccine candidates.
  • Dependence on government funding (HHS BARDA) which may be reduced, delayed, or terminated.
  • Potential for significant volatility in the stock price due to its OTCQX listing and speculative nature.
  • Risks associated with intellectual property protection and potential litigation.
  • Geopolitical instability and macroeconomic conditions impacting supply chains and capital markets.

Future Outlook

The Company expects to continue incurring significant operating losses and negative cash flows. It plans to use the proceeds from the Lincoln Park Purchase Agreement for working capital and general corporate purposes, including research and development. The Company believes its current cash position is sufficient to fund operations into the second quarter of 2027.

Legal Proceedings

  • The Company was involved in securities class action litigation (Himmelberg v. Vaxart, Inc. et al.) which reached a partial settlement in 2022.
  • The Company was a nominal defendant in a Section 16(b) lawsuit (Roth v. Armistice Capital LLC, et al.) which was dismissed in favor of the defendants.
